免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发和企业id有什么区别

APP开发和企业ID虽然都是在企业信息化建设中需要涉及到的概念,但是它们的含义、用途和实现方式是完全不同的。接下来,我将详细介绍APP开发和企业ID的区别。

一、APP开发

APP(Application)开发可以简单地理解为一种用于在移动设备上部署应用程序的技术。按照应用场景的不同,APP开发主要可以分为三大类:原生应用开发、混合应用开发和HTML5应用开发。

原生应用开发使用本地SDK,是指由本地原生代码编写的应用,可以部署在不同操作系统上。这种方式开发出来的APP质量更高、功能更丰富、体验更好,但是开发成本比较高,同时还需要针对不同操作系统分别进行开发。

混合应用开发是将原生技术与Web技术相结合,使用HTML、CSS和JavaScript等Web技术编写,利用原生应用作为Web View容器来传递内容和代码。这种方式开发出来的APP可以实现跨平台开发,但是部分功能受限制、体验受到影响。

HTML5应用开发是基于HTML5的Web应用程序,以HTML、CSS和JavaScript等Web技术为基础,利用一些HTML5特性来获得更好的功能支持和体验。这种方式开发出来的APP对设备的适配性很好,可以实现跨平台开发,但是需要处理一些特定的问题,如页面样式适配、性能方面等。

二、企业ID

企业ID(Identification)是指企业在网络上进行业务打造时,为了实现对企业本身和员工之间的精细管理、安全控制和知识管理所起的作用。在企业信息化建设中,企业ID主要使用在企业的各种内部系统中,例如OA、ERP、CRM等,其核心功能是验证和授权。

企业ID主要通过身份认证和权限控制来掌控企业各种业务系统的访问权限,具体来说,企业ID通过身份认证实现对用户身份进行验证,然后再通过权限管理来决定用户可以获得哪些资源的访问权限。这种方式保证了企业内部的安全性。

三、区别

APP开发和企业ID的区别在于,前者是一种技术手段,主要用于实现移动设备上的应用程序,主要开发面向的是外部客户。后者则是一种管理控制手段,主要用于掌控企业内部各种应用系统的访问权限和资源控制,主要面向的是企业内部人员。

企业ID的使用主要体现在身份验证上,通过验证用户的身份来确定是否具有访问内部企业资源的资格。而APP开发则是为了开发满足客户需求的应用程序,因而开发的侧重点完全不同。

在实现上,APP开发需要考虑的方面主要是移动设备的机型、不同的操作系统和网络环境等,而企业ID则需要考虑用户密码的加密存储、密码策略控制、登录失败锁定和可信认证身份识别等方面。由此可见,企业ID的实现难度比APP开发更大,同时其所涉及的管理内容也更为复杂。

四、总结

APP开发和企业ID虽然都是企业信息化建设中需要涉及到的概念,但是它们的含义、用途和实现方式是完全不同的。APP开发主要用于开发移动设备上的应用程序,针对的是企业的外部客户。而企业ID则主要用于企业内部各种应用系统的访问权限和资源控制,针对的是企业内部人员。


相关知识:
如何用github开发app
GitHub是一个基于Git的版本控制系统,是全球最大的开源社区,也是开发者们最喜欢的协作开发平台之一。在GitHub上开发app的过程,需要经历以下步骤:1. 创建仓库首先,需要在GitHub上创建一个新的仓库。点击“New Repository”按钮,
2024-01-10
app软件开发人员外包
App软件开发人员外包是指将软件开发项目的开发工作委托给外部的开发团队或个人来完成。这种模式在互联网行业中非常常见,它能够帮助企业降低开发成本、提高开发效率,并且能够快速响应市场需求。在App软件开发人员外包模式下,企业可以将开发任务委托给专业的开发团队或
2023-06-29
app开发外包需要重视哪些事
在进行app开发外包时,有一些重要的事项需要特别关注。以下是一些你应该重视的事项:1. 确定项目目标和需求:在开始外包之前,确保你清楚地了解项目的目标和需求。这包括确定应用程序的功能,用户界面设计,平台要求等。与外包团队进行充分的讨论和沟通,以确保他们理解
2023-06-29
app开发团队多少钱
App开发团队的价格因多个因素而异,包括项目的复杂性、开发团队的规模和经验、所在地区的成本等。在这篇文章中,我将详细介绍App开发团队的价格原理,并提供一些参考信息。1. 开发团队的规模和经验:App开发团队的规模和经验是决定价格的重要因素之一。通常来说,
2023-06-29
app开发聚合获取权限怎么弄
移动应用的许多功能需要访问设备的各种资源或与第三方服务交互,比如摄像头、联系人、地理位置、网络通信等等。为了不破坏用户隐私和安全,现代操作系统(如Android和iOS)都采用了权限管理机制,让用户可以控制每个应用程序可以访问哪些资源或执行哪些操作。因此,
2023-06-29
apple正在与开发人员合作
自从苹果公司推出了App Store以来,其生态系统已经成为了开发人员和用户的宠儿。然而,自从2018年以来,苹果公司一直在与开发人员合作推进其生态系统,并努力使其发展更加健康、有益和安全。首先,苹果公司与开发人员的合作重点是提高应用程序的质量。这是通过开
2023-05-06